Walling Alternatives
Walling is described as 'Working on a project, researching a topic or writing an article? Walling makes it easy to break down your ideas, refine them and visually organize them' and is a Note-taking tool in the office & productivity category. There are more than 100 alternatives to Walling for a variety of platforms, including Web-based, Mac, Windows, SaaS and Linux apps. The best Walling alternative is Trello, which is free. Other great apps like Walling are Notesnook, Microsoft Word, Zim and AFFiNE.
